Installation of a modular substation including civil engineering works to construct…
Navan Retail Park , Navan , Co Meath
Proposed development
The development will consist of the installation of a modular substation including civil engineering works to construct the foundation along with an access route for ESBN vehicles.
What happens next
Permission was granted on 7 Oct 2025. Third parties may appeal within four weeks; after that the permission is final and works can start once a commencement notice is lodged.
